Brimfield College-- The present college structure was erected in the Summer season of 1877. The plans and requirements were pulled in Peoria by a guy by the name of Quail, and was gotten and constructed by Bryson & Silloway.


The price of the building and furniture was $11,000. Today directors are Milton Duncan, Dr. Lowe and James Farnum. The principal is R. Rock Hillside; aides, Frank E. Pummer, Ella Hall, Ellen G. Slattery and Ada Hall. The college is split right into five divisions and concerning fifty in a department, making a presence of 250, with good and effective educators, and is in a thriving problem.


In 2012, Peoria County Farm Bureau celebrated 100 years. Formation of the organization began on September 2, 1912, at the Peoria Region Pomona Grange's Annual Labor Day Picnic in Alta.
